Condensation of solids in space. Isotope fractionation in the model system C-O

Abstract

The reported chemical fractionation of a single isotope O-16 under simulated space conditions provides the first experimental proof for the hypothesis that the oxygen isotopic anomaly (and other similar anomalies) seen in meteorites is a product of chemical fractionation in interstellar or circumstellar space. Work proposed on this subject was discontinued because a peer review determined that such effects could not possibly exist and that continued support of this project would be a wasted effort. A bibliography is included of articles generated during research in this area
